Materials Used in Medical Grade Gloves
The materials used to manufacture medical grade gloves play a crucial role in determining their safety for food preparation. Nitrile gloves, for example, are made from a synthetic rubber that is resistant to oils, fuels, and certain chemicals. They are also hypoallergenic and latex-free, making them an excellent choice for individuals with latex allergies. Latex gloves, on the other hand, are made from natural rubber and are known for their high elasticity and tactile sensitivity. However, they may contain proteins that can cause allergic reactions in some individuals.
Chemical Resistance and Food Safety
Medical grade gloves are designed to provide a barrier against chemicals and bodily fluids, but their chemical resistance may not necessarily translate to food safety. Some chemicals used in the manufacturing process, such as accelerators and antioxidants, can potentially migrate into food, posing a risk to human health. Furthermore, medical grade gloves may not be tested for their ability to prevent the transfer of foodborne pathogens, such as Escherichia coli (E. coli) and Salmonella.
Regulatory Frameworks and Food Safety Standards
Regulatory frameworks play a vital role in ensuring the safety of medical grade gloves for food preparation. In the United States, the FDA regulates medical devices, including gloves, under the Medical Device Amendments to the Federal Food, Drug, and Cosmetic Act. The FDA requires medical device manufacturers to comply with Good Manufacturing Practices (GMPs) and to conduct biocompatibility testing to ensure the safety of their products.
Food Safety Standards and Certifications
Food safety standards, such as those set by the US Department of Agriculture (USDA) and the Food and Agriculture Organization (FAO) of the United Nations, provide guidelines for the safe handling and preparation of food. Some medical grade gloves may carry certifications, such as NSF International or ISO 22000, which indicate compliance with food safety standards. However, these certifications may not necessarily guarantee the safety of the gloves for food preparation.
Limitations of Regulatory Frameworks
While regulatory frameworks provide a foundation for ensuring the safety of medical grade gloves, there are limitations to their effectiveness. The FDA, for example, does not specifically regulate medical grade gloves for food preparation, and the USDA’s food safety standards may not address the use of medical grade gloves in food handling. Furthermore, the lack of standardization in the manufacturing process and the variability in glove quality can make it difficult to ensure the safety of medical grade gloves for food preparation.

Can medical grade gloves be used for food preparation, and what are the potential risks?
While medical grade gloves may appear to be a convenient and hygienic option for food preparation, they are not recommended for this use. Medical grade gloves are designed to meet the strict standards of medical settings, and may contain chemicals or materials that are not safe for contact with food. For example, some medical grade gloves may contain powders or lubricants that can contaminate food, or may be made from materials that can leach chemicals into food. Using medical grade gloves for food preparation can pose a risk to consumer health, as these chemicals can cause allergic reactions, gastrointestinal illness, or other adverse health effects.
The potential risks associated with using medical grade gloves for food preparation are significant, and can have serious consequences for consumers. For example, if medical grade gloves contain high levels of chemicals like latex or phthalates, these can migrate into food and cause allergic reactions or other health problems. Similarly, if medical grade gloves are not manufactured to meet food safety standards, they may harbor microorganisms like bacteria or viruses that can contaminate food and cause illness. As a result, it is essential to use gloves that are specifically designed for food preparation and handling, and to follow proper hygiene and sanitation practices to minimize the risk of contamination.

How can I determine if a glove is safe for food preparation, and what certifications should I look for?
To determine if a glove is safe for food preparation, it is essential to look for certifications from reputable organizations, such as the FDA or the National Sanitation Foundation (NSF). These certifications indicate that the gloves have been tested and meet strict standards for safety and purity. Additionally, food handlers should check the glove’s material composition, to ensure that it is made from a safe and non-toxic material. They should also check the glove’s manufacturing process, to ensure that it meets high standards for quality and control.
When selecting gloves for food preparation, food handlers should look for certifications like FDA 21 CFR or NSF International. These certifications indicate that the gloves have been tested and meet strict standards for safety and purity, and are safe for contact with food. Food handlers should also check the glove’s packaging and labeling, to ensure that it is clearly marked as “food grade” or “safe for food contact.” By selecting gloves that meet these standards, food handlers can minimize the risk of contamination and ensure that food is prepared and handled in a safe and hygienic manner.
